Socialist vs communist. December 15, 2021. Thirty years ago, in the early days of December 1991, the vast communist empire of the Soviet Union formally and unceremoniously collapsed. It was, in a sense, the end of the global movement that played an extraordinary role in defining the human dreams and the devastating geopolitical conflicts of the 20th century.

Mar 11, 2024 · communism, political and economic doctrine that aims to replace private property and a profit-based economy with public ownership and communal control of at least the major means of production (e.g., mines, mills, and factories) and the natural resources of a society. Communism is thus a form of socialism —a higher and more advanced form ... The two are often used interchangeably, even by entire governments and political le...Socialism succeeds capitalism, and is heralded by the working class's seizing of the state. Using that power, the working class then assumes control over the means of production, either by ...Socialism is an economic system, Communism is a societal system. In this case, Socialism = "Worker ownership of the means of production", whereas Communism = "A stateless, classless, moneyless society with Socialism as the economic system." This is what you'll find modern leftists using most of the time. It can include many ideologies nowadays though it … 2. Socialism vs. Communism in Marxist Thought. Although this article focuses on socialism rather than Marxism per se, there is an important distinction within Marxist thought that warrants mention here. This is the distinction between socialism and communism. Both socialism and communism are forms of post-capitalism. socialism.
